The Ejisu Presby Junior High School (JHS) won an inter-schools quiz competition organised by the Ejisu Juaben District Directorate of Education for all the JHS in the Ejisu Circuit on Monday.
Speaking to GNA after the quiz, Mr. Ebenezer Bekoe, Ejisu Circuit Supervisor, said the competition, which covered all the subjects being studied at the JHS level, was to assess the performance of both the teachers and students.
He commended all the participating schools for demonstrating high academic standards during the competition.
Mr. Bekoe said the Directorate would continue to organise such programmes for students periodically to motivate them to learn hard.
Some of the schools, which took part in the competition, were Ejisu District Assembly, Ejisu Roman Catholic, Krapa JHS, Asotwe JHS, Besease District Assembly JHS and Ejisu Presby JHS.
The students commended the organizers of the programme and urged them to sustain it.
